1 crore 10 lakh users left Reliance Jio, are Airtel and Voda better?

All telecom companies, including Reliance Jio, had increased the tariff charges in December 2021, which affected Reliance in the first quarter of 2022. There has been a decrease of around 1 crore 10 lakh in the subscribers of Reliance Jio. India’s largest telecom company has given this information in the data released on Friday. Reliance Jio has said that in the first quarter of March 2022, the company’s standalone net profit has increased by 24 percent and in this quarter this profit reached 4,173 crores. This increase is due to increased tariffs, subscriber mix and FTTH services.

The company said year-on-year standalone revenue on account of operations grew by 20.4 per cent to Rs 20,901 crore, the company said. However, after increasing the tariff, the customer base of the company has come down by 1 crore 9 lakhs. Consolidated net profit for Jio Platforms, the unit that holds telecom and digital businesses, grew 23 per cent to Rs 4,313 crore. Gross revenue grew by 21 per cent to Rs 26,139 crore for the quarter ending March 2022.

The company’s total customer base stood at 412 million for March 2022. While the Average Revenue Per Unit (ARPU) stood at Rs 167.7 per subscriber per month. The same figure was Rs 151.6 per subscriber per month for December. If we look at the year on year basis, according to the company, this ARPU shows a growth of 21.3 percent while it shows a growth of 10.5 percent on quarter on quarter basis. The company’s total traffic during the first quarter was 24.6 billion GB (24 billion 600 million GB), a growth of 47.5 percent.

The company’s gross revenue for this year is Rs 95,804 crore, which is a growth of 17.1 percent over the previous year. Jio Platforms net profit for FY22 was reported to be Rs 15,487 crore, which is a growth of 23.6 per cent over the previous financial year. The company’s statement said that after the tariff hike in December, its customer base decreased by 1 crore 9 lakhs. Although the company’s Gross Edition still remains strong and has increased by 3 crore 50 lakhs. Average data and voice usage per user increased by 19.7GB and 968 minutes per month, respectively, in the March 2022 quarter.
